Make sure its not hard Styrofoam or it will just transfer the vibration right through and back to the sump.

You can build silent sumps, just make sure all water pipes return and draw from under water. No air, no splashing, and damping pads for the pumps, and if you can use tubing rather then pvc to connect the pump, as the pvc will carry the vibration to the tank, which will carry it to the stand, ect ect noise.
